Despite a delivery drop-off, vehicle production was up 20% sequentially, further fuelling lithium demand. The company's ambitious ramp-up plan should still allow it to meet full year delivery targets.
Tesla Motors Inc. reported delivery of 14,370 vehicles in
Q2, 450 fewer than in Q1.The company blamed the lower delivery
rate on an "extreme production ramp […] and the high mix
of customer-ordered vehicles still on trucks and ships at the
end of the quarter".Tesla’s Q2 vehicle production
